Cook bacon in large nonstick skillet until crisp. Drain bacon, reserving drippings in skillet. Crumble bacon; set aside.
2
Add chicken to skillet. Season well with pepper; cover. Cook 4 min. on each side or until cooked through. Remove chicken from skillet.
3
Add broth, water and greens to skillet; stir. Bring to boil.
4
Stir in rice. Top with chicken; cover. Cook on medium-low heat 5 min. Remove from heat. Let stand 5 to 7 min. or until liquid is absorbed. Stir. Sprinkle with reserved crumbled bacon.
